Web29 de jan. de 2024 · A home equity line of credit, or HELOC, is a secured loan backed by your home. Instead of taking out a lump sum, borrowers are given access to a credit line, similar to how a credit card works, and only charged interest on the amount they use. If you have multiple high-interest credit balances, you can use a HELOC to pay down your debt faster and reduce the interest you pay. With a HELOC you can consolidate credit card and personal loans payments at potentially lower interest rates.
